Output 43eb97c3192f2a7f00a0e333b379676ebd0aae53cc24d34088b8a336d9e73ec6:1

value
29988570
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d2161b113dea8a6f73ca8934e7e377966d28f00926e48a15945620c740729ae2
address
tb1p6gtpkyfaa29x7u723y6w0cmhjekj3uqfymjg59v52csvwsrjnt3qwe5pfd
transaction
43eb97c3192f2a7f00a0e333b379676ebd0aae53cc24d34088b8a336d9e73ec6
confirmations
3730
spent
true